Resident Evil 6 says it wants a minimum of a 8800 GTS, the "HD Graphics 4000" is not as good as that, so just judging by graphics requirement.. i'd say the game won't run. On the other hand, sometimes you get lucky and stuff will run on an underpowered system afterall.
